Stop Smoking Programs- What Works
Everyone now knows that smoking is bad for your health, but it is a very hard habit to quit. You see advertisements everywhere for various stop smoking programs. How do you know which one to choose? Nothing offered works for all people, each person must find the approach that best suits their needs.
The methods employed by stop smoking programs include hypnosis. The strategy of using hypnosis to quit smoking can be advantageous for the person who wants to quit. There are no drugs or substitutes for tobacco involved, and the treatments can be effective. Many medical professional deem hypnosis an appropriate tool in the fight to quit smoking. There are drawbacks, however, including that multiple sessions may be required and some people cannot be induced into a hypnotic state.
You can also use medicines to stop you from wanting to smoke. You will need to visit a doctor, and get a prescription. This can cost a lot of money. There are side effects that come along with these medications. Of course, the risks of smoking are probably worse than any side effects that you will encounter.
Some people like to utilize an herbal remedy to stop smoking. There are a few herbs and combinations that are used to help in this respect. You may need to try several different combinations before finding the one that is right for you. The herb lobelia seems to copy the effect of nicotine and is helpful in converting from smoking to non-smoking.
There are a number of stop smoking programs that you can use when you are thinking of quitting smoking that use some form of acupuncture. The traditional method involves small, painless needles which claim to block the desired to smoke a cigarette. Alternatively you can have a surgical staple inserted in the air while you are trying to quit.
For stop smoking programs to be successful they must offer counseling and support to their patients. Sometimes this counseling alone is used to help quit smoking. The physical addiction from smoking can be remedied in several days but the mental reliance can continue for quite a while. That is why the best programs offer consideration to the mental outlook of the smoker.
